Description


Jo flees the country without telling a soul in a dramatic quest for freedom and self-knowledge. In the beautiful surroundings of a former palace in the snow-capped Himalayas, she has the time and space to reflect on her life. The peace she finds there helps Jo to unravel her turmoil, but unexpected challenges test her new-found equilibrium to the limit. 

 

Finding Jo focuses on relationships between families, lovers and friends, and the resentment and long-held beliefs that threaten to destroy them. Jo's desire for a deeper purpose in life acts as a catalyst to other family members back at home.
